Many on the board have given Ross stick over having low football IQ. Has anyone considered that much of Ross' struggles stem from the style clash between himself and Rom? It appears both would like to play completely different games.

How often have we seen Everton break out on the counter, only for a link up pass between one or the other to find the feet of an opponent with the other's hands up to the heavens in disgust, because he made a different run that wasn't spotted?

Personally, I'd like to see how Ross would fare with a striker that has the command over the ball to maintain possession in the final third, and the eye to pick a pass and enable more of our midfield to get forward. It would be interesting to see a center forward that was more interested in creating team goals than demanding the perfect pass to knock in a sitter.
